Federal Government Allocates N700bn for Free Meter Distribution

Federal Government Allocates N700bn for Free Meter Distribution

The Federal Government has set aside N700 billion to implement the distribution of free electricity meters under the Presidential Metering Initiative (PMI). The Federal government is deducting N100bn monthly from the federation revenue to address the 50 percent metering gap. Jared Isaacman Nominated as NASA Administrator by Trump

Jared Isaacman Nominated as NASA Administrator by Trump

US President-elect Donald Trump has nominated Jared Isaacman, a 41-year-old billionaire entrepreneur and founder of Shift4 Payments, as the next head of NASA. Isaacman, a pioneer in commercial spaceflight and the first private astronaut to conduct a spacewalk, has played a key role in shaping the future of space exploration through his collaboration with SpaceX. … Read more
